Let’s start with the design phase. This is like the blueprint for the whole project. We can’t just jump into making stuff without a proper plan. When we get an order for auxiliary machinery, our team of designers rolls up their sleeves. They first sit down with the client to figure out exactly what they need. Whether it’s a small – scale machine for a local workshop or a large – scale industrial one, understanding the requirements is key.
We take into account things like the function of the machine. Is it for sorting, packaging, or maybe something else in the manufacturing line? The size also matters a lot. We need to make sure it fits into the client’s existing setup. And then there’s the efficiency factor. We aim to design machines that can do the job quickly and with as little energy consumption as possible.
Once the design is finalized, it’s time to source the materials. We’re really picky about the materials we use. For example, if we’re making a conveyor belt system (which is a common type of auxiliary machinery), we’ll look for high – quality rubber for the belt and strong metal for the frame. We have a network of trusted suppliers who provide us with the best materials. We don’t want to cut corners here because using sub – standard materials can lead to frequent breakdowns and unhappy customers.
After getting the materials, the machining process begins. This is where we use a whole bunch of tools to shape the raw materials into the parts we need. For metal parts, we might use lathes to turn the metal and create smooth, round shapes. Milling machines are also super important. They can cut out all sorts of complex shapes from metal blocks.
If we’re making plastic parts, injection molding is the go – to process. We heat the plastic until it turns into a liquid state and then inject it into a mold. Once it cools down, we get a perfectly formed plastic part. It’s a pretty cool process, and the quality of the parts we get from injection molding is usually top – notch.
Welding is another crucial step in the manufacturing of auxiliary machinery. When we need to join metal parts together, welding is the way to go. We have experienced welders who know how to create strong, reliable joints. They have to be really careful because a bad weld can compromise the entire structure of the machine.
Assembly is like the final jigsaw puzzle. We take all the parts we’ve made and start putting them together to form the complete auxiliary machine. This requires a lot of precision. We have to make sure that all the parts fit together perfectly. We use a combination of hand – tools and sometimes automated assembly equipment to speed up the process.
Once the machine is assembled, it goes through a series of tests. We can’t just send it off to the customer without making sure it works properly. We test the machine under different conditions to see how it performs. For example, if it’s a conveyor belt, we’ll load it with different weights and see if it can move them smoothly. If it’s a packaging machine, we’ll test it with different types of products to make sure it can package them correctly.
If any issues are found during the testing phase, our technicians work hard to fix them. We don’t want to send out a machine that’s going to cause problems for the customer right away. After all, our reputation depends on providing high – quality products.
After the machine passes all the tests, we do the finishing touches. This includes things like painting the machine to protect it from corrosion and adding labels for easy operation and maintenance instructions.
